Transaction 26306924377903efee00d75c7ccd344e6ad737e6850b086c2c95d1ff9a5a6191
1 Input
1 Output
-
26306924377903efee00d75c7ccd344e6ad737e6850b086c2c95d1ff9a5a6191:0
- value
- 44452
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b68ae7118b7a1fecd15a7e755eb400d762d52fd
- address
- bc1qrd52uugck7slang45ln4t66qp4mz65hatg4zqy